KI ( potassium iodide) is an ionically bonded molecule.

The metal potassium (K) ; kalium) ionises to form the potassium cation K^(+)

The iodine atom has electron affinity to accept one electron into its outer energy shell to complete its octet, to form the iodide anion I^(-) .Since both these ions have a charge of '1' , but of opposite charge, they are attracted like the north and south poles of a magnet., to form the molecule potassium iodide (KI).

Covalency and metallic bonding do not come into consideration.

Hence

K = K^(+) + e^(-)

e^(-) + I = I^(-)

'Adding'

K + I = K^(+) + I^(-) = K^(+)I^(-). shortened to KI

Is nh3 is ionic covalent or metallic?

NH3 is a covalent compound because it is made up of nonmetals (nitrogen and hydrogen), which share electrons to form covalent bonds. It does not contain any metal atoms, so it is not ionic or metallic in nature.
